Pararthya NGO’s “Project Rahat” drive to bring relief to migrant workers in Delhi NCR

July 29, 2021

As an endeavour to do service to the society, NGO Pararthya Sustainable Development & Environment Conservation Society, supported by Viraaj Ventures and funded by Realty Assistant, conducted Project Rahat, a social development drive for CSR 2020, which they distributed clothes, organised donation drive, and did various activities in the different parts of the capital region to help those severely affected by winter season in a pandemic-stricken environment.

The initiative was dedicated to bringing relief to the migrants of Delhi and NCR region who lost their jobs to COVID-19. The project was aimed at making people aware of the importance of following personal hygiene amidst the winter doubly hit by the life taking impact of COVID-19.

According to the IMD, in the past decade, the country has seen 506 per cent increase in cold waves which accounted for more number of deaths due to cold waves as compared to the heat waves. The major reason for death is the unavailability of shelter and clothing to shield one from the cold waves.

As part of the endeavour, four teams visited areas massively populated by people living on roadside, taking refuge at shelter homes or setting up their own jhuggis during the seven days drive. Soaps, sanitisers, masks and water bottles were distributed that was perfectly complemented by providing them with guidance for proper sanitising practices, the correct way to wear a mask and how to effectively practise social distancing.

“Continuing the humanitarian legacy, at Pararthya we were determined to extend our support to the suffering working section of the society for which ‘Project Rahat’ was incepted to save the lives lost due to the extreme winters,” said Ankit Aditya Pradhan, Founder & CEO, Realty Assistant.

Along with this, as part of the donation drive, 200+ blankets, 500+ warm clothes, 500+ soaps, 300+ sanitisers, 500+ masks, 100+ bread packets, 2 cartons of 120 biscuit packets and 10 toffee packets were also distributed.
